    Local information

    • Oxford North, OX2 is strategically located in Oxford connecting to the City Centre, Summertown, Jericho, Headington, Cowley, Woodstock, Witney and beyond. Promoting sustainable travel, Oxford North offers a landmark and secure cycle pavilion, showering facilities, new bus stops and routes for people who live, work and visit.
    • By bike: There are 1.6 miles of new cycle paths connecting into the wider cycle network including Headington and City Centre and it is 15 minutes by e-bike via Oxford Canal to the City Centre. Summertown, Jericho and Westgate are all easily accessible.
    • By bus: Oxford North benefits from fast and frequent bus services including H2, S2, 300, S3 and City 6: From A40; Stagecoach S1 - Carterton to Oxford, Stagecoach S2 - Witney to Oxford, Stagecoach H2 - Witney to John Radcliffe Hospital, Oxford Tube - Witney via Thornhill Park & Ride to London Victoria. From A44; Stagecoach S3 - Chipping North/ Charlbury to City to Oxford Station, Park & Ride 300 - Peartree Park & Ride to City to Redbridge Park & Ride. Future services; Regular shuttle bus to Oxford Parkway, Oxford North - Headington and Cowley.
    • By road: There are strategic road connections via the A40, A44 and A34 providing access to the M40 motorway via Junction 8 and 8a to London and Birmingham. The A34 links to Bicester in the north and Winchester in the south to the M4 and onto the M3 motorway and to the port of Southampton. The A44 provides access to Evesham and Worcester in the northwest through the Cotswolds. The City Centre is 3 miles south of Wolvercote roundabout.
    • By rail: Oxford Parkway is five minutes by dedicated shuttle bus (coming 2025) linking directly into London Marylebone with trains departing every 30 minutes taking from 55 minutes, Bicester Village from 8 minutes, and High Wycombe from 36 minutes.
    • By air: London Oxford Airport offers regional and business aviation with London Heathrow being approximately 37 miles to the southeast.
